2013-12-08 2 views
-1

Я показываю данные api на моей веб-странице, используя php и google places api. Я успешно показал имя, адрес и номер телефона, указав ссылку на место. Теперь я хочу отобразить места фото данного места. я использую следующее:Google Places API Места Фото

file_get_contents("https://maps.googleapis.com/maps/api/place/photo?maxwidth=400&photoreference=CnRoAAAAQiZS7dkiWqMWPMmhidMrAH9CyZ3Q2hMwYENL_dW2h8e3d9euO-LZAIq3cbMPRIFvXzEGWDblLujlfP2g6z54OSngjcQ8zJkVcAAHyDk0zJxFhVXLd6cPO7E-jV2WK6P7LjFo8Uknj-2QSueyVBsSQhIQXLO7JEU-vWdshr3NfqyGWRoUmtUSVOWxSOKq4AzhKyUE_M_wHYI&sensor=false&key=MYKEY"); 

Это вернуть исходные данные. Как я могу отобразить изображение этого места. если вы поставили выше url в адресной строке браузера и дали ключ, ваш получит изображение.

Но я не могу сделать это на своей веб-странице, используя php или html.

С уважением

+0

Это не работает в [ '' тег (как атрибут Src)] (http://www.w3schools.com/ теги/tag_img.asp)? – geocodezip

ответ

0

Вы можете просто сделать:

$imageContent = file_get_contents("___YOURGMAPSURL___"); 
file_put_contents("map.jpg", $imageContent);